Transaction d8632181ff3316df905545081e78dbd45bd584973803c8c359e40ea02f3eb379
1 Input
1 Output
-
d8632181ff3316df905545081e78dbd45bd584973803c8c359e40ea02f3eb379:0
- value
- 8790545
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58177995c80c9f6d7ec8ff5f890a2a93121ae88e OP_EQUAL
- address
- MFvwpNvaFZXbXgXhWMNi7dobGwurgGWBDZ